Off the back of Patek's amazing looking case - I've placed an order with Simon.

I'm fortunate enough to own a SAB Westminster case in London Tan with full wraparound straps, so will have a pretty solid benchmark to compare it against.

To provide something a little different to the SAB, I've ordered a short strapped briefcase in Sedgwick Dark Havana bridle leather. 3 compartments (with the centre compartment a little larger than the others to accomodate bulky items). Full size rear pocket. Chrome plated brass hardware. Shoulder strap,

Here's a sample of the Dark Havana leather. I was expecting something near black based on Sedgwick's website, but the sample is just the shade of brown I was after:





And a selection of chrome locks to choose from:



Hopefully will be completed by the end of January - will keep this thread updated with pics (that Simon is kind enough to send you as your order progresses).
